#2361ff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2361ff is composed of 13.7% red, 38%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.3% cyan, 62%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 223.1 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 56.9%. #2361ff color hex could be obtained by blending #46c2ff with #0000ff.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#2361ff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2361ff has RGB values of R:35, G:97, B:255 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.62,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 2318847.
